8 CHURCH FARM ROAD is a large extended detached house of 131m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966, which could now be worth an estimated £467,322. It was last sold for £300,000 in October 2014, which was around 27% above the average October 2014 detached price in the King's Lynn and West Norfolk local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2013,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the King's Lynn and West Norfolk local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D sales from July 2007 and October 2014 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 2007 sale was for 12%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 12% above the HPI over time, until the October 2014 sale, where it rises to 27%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 27% above the HPI.

What might 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D be worth now?

8 CHURCH FARM ROAD might now be worth an estimated £467,322.

This is based on house price inflation of 55.8%, between October 2014 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the King's Lynn and West Norfolk local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 55.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D of £300,000 on 3rd October 2014. For the value to have increased from £300,000 to £467,322 over the eleven years and eight months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the King's Lynn and West Norfolk local authority area.
  • The October 2014 sale price of £300,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D has not materially changed since October 2014.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

8 CHURCH FARM ROAD: Plot and Title Map

8 CHURCH FARM 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.257 of an acre, or 1,041m². The below map shows the location of 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 8 CHURCH FARM 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
